Which fruits can control blood sugar after drinking after breaking the wall

A wall breaker can beat fruit into a delicate juice, but not all fruits are suitable for blood sugar control. For diabetics or people who need to control their blood sugar, it is more appropriate to choose fruits with a low glycemic index (GI). Here are some fruits that can be drunk in moderation after breaking the wall:

blueberry

Blueberries are rich in antioxidants and have less of an impact on blood sugar.

Strawberry

Strawberries have a low GI and are suitable for blood sugar control.

cherry

Cherries have a low GI value and are rich in vitamins and minerals.

apple

Choose apple varieties with high acidity and high fiber content, such as green apples, which have a relatively low GI value.

pear

Pears have a low GI and are rich in fiber.

Watermelon

Although the GI value of watermelon is not low, the actual glycemic load may be low due to the high water content.

Wall-breaking recipes for low GI fruits

Here's a detailed recipe for low-GI fruits for blood sugar control:

material

Blueberries 100 grams

Strawberries 100 grams

Cherries 50 grams

1 apple (choose green apples with high acidity and high fiber content)

1 pear

Purified water to taste

steps

Wash the blueberries, strawberries and cherries and set aside.

Apples and pears are also washed and cut into small pieces or slices.

Place all the fruits in the wall breaker.

Add an appropriate amount of purified water, not exceeding the maximum capacity of the wall breaker.

Start the wall breaker, select the juice mode, and stir the fruit until it is fine.

Once the wall is broken, you can adjust whether to add honey or other natural sweeteners according to your personal taste.

Pour the broken wall juice into a glass and serve.

Precautions

Diabetics or those who need to control their blood sugar should consume it in moderation and pay attention to the overall balance of the diet.

When breaking the wall, avoid adding sugar to maintain the original flavor of the fruit.

When drinking fruit juice, do not overdo it to avoid excessive sugar intake.
